Harji Ram Burdak (15 July 1931 – 20 December 2013) was an Indian politician. He served as minister of agriculture in Government of Rajasthan. He was member of the Indian National Congress. He was elected to the Rajasthan Legislative Assembly for six terms between 1967 and 2013.[1][2][3]
